This coming Saturday, August 17, at 2:30 pm in the Clifton Public Library, our Alliance will be hosting its second of three Know Your Housing Rights events.

This week’s event will focus on housing rights for mobile home park residents, whether you rent the home or rent the land your home is on. The information will be presented by local organizations and our legal expert with the Colorado Poverty Law Center, who will be ready to answer any questions you may have.
